Thielsen Takes Over John Thielsen took the job of head custodian in January when Mike Schaffner retired. Thielsen joined a staff consisting of six cooks, supervised by Marlene Kessler, and seven bus drivers, managed by Pat Schaffner. To- gether these people kept the school running smoothly throughout the year. Thielsen feels that the best part of his job is working with the friendly staff. However, Thielsen commented that the worst part of his job is that “everything seems to go wrong at the same time.” John Bendewald and John Thielson keep the school in tc form throughout the year. Journalists Record Year For the LHS journalism staff, 1982- 83 was a busy, productive year. It began early when the three editors attended a workshop at Presenta- tion College to gather ideas for the 1983 Buccaneer. In October the en- tire staff traveled to Brookings for Press Day, where they attended workshops on newspaper and year- book journalism and also picked up an All State award for the 1982 Buccaneer. The ten member staff, which was responsible for publishing both the yearbook and LHS Live, was led by Editor Patricia Lapka, Assistant Edi- tor Cathy Glaesman, Junior Editor Cindi Schmidt, and Adviser Mrs. Ju- lie George.
